#412e09 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#412e09 is composed of 25.5% red, 18%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.2% magenta, 86.2% yellow and 74.5% black. It has a hue angle of 39.6 degrees, a saturation of 75.7% and a lightness of 14.5%. #412e09 color hex could be obtained by blending #825c12 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#412e09 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#412e09 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#412e09 has RGB values of R:65, G:46,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.86,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 4271625.

Shades and Tints of #412e09
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0902 is the darkest color, while #fefd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#412e09
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#272623 is the less saturated color, while #4a3100 is the most saturated one.
